First and common suggestion was to -
1. Export contacts to excel,
2. Import to gmail and
3. Sync on new phone.
Seriously??!!...was surprised to learn that there is no easy way to export contacts from windows to android and what if someone didn't want to upload contacts to gmail and sync?
Post an hour of research; resorted to -
1. Install "Contacts Backup -- Excel & Email Support" app on Windows Phone
2. Using the app, export contacts as excel to email
3. Create VCard file using below code...Ref: convert-contacts-in-excel-to-vcf-format
4. Email VCard file and Import into new phone
Code -
Sub Create_VCF()
'Open a File in Specific Path in Output or Append mode
Dim FileNum As Integer
Dim iRow As Double
iRow = 2
FileNum = FreeFile
OutFilePath = ThisWorkbook.Path & "\OutputVCF.VCF"
Open OutFilePath For Output As FileNum
'Loop through Excel Sheet each row and write it to VCF File
While VBA.Trim(Sheets("Sheet1").Cells(iRow, 1)) <> ""
FName = VBA.Trim(Sheets("Sheet1").Cells(iRow, 1))
LName = VBA.Trim(Sheets("Sheet1").Cells(iRow, 2))
PhNum = VBA.Trim(Sheets("Sheet1").Cells(iRow, 3))
Print #FileNum, "BEGIN:VCARD"
Print #FileNum, "VERSION:3.0"
Print #FileNum, "N:" & FName & ";" & LName & ";;;"
Print #FileNum, "FN:" & FName & " " & LName
Print #FileNum, "TEL;TYPE=CELL;TYPE=PREF:" & PhNum
Print #FileNum, "END:VCARD"
iRow = iRow + 1
Wend
'Close the File
Close #FileNum
MsgBox "Contacts Converted to Saved To: " & OutFilePath
End Sub
Hopefully someone would save their precious time!
